The Verdantfrost greenhouse controller recalibrates its humidity and temperature sensors nightly because both drift measurably over a 24-hour cycle. Drift corrections are computed on the controller and written to a calibration log; raw and corrected readings are stored side by side so anomalies can be audited. For the security review, note that calibration writes use a service account with insert-only rights, and nothing in the field firmware holds admin credentials. The calibration database the service account targets is below.

warehouse DSN: clickhouse://druys_svc:Pl@db-47e1.orvexstack.corp:5432/beldor

**Ticket GH-412: Greenhouse sensor drift — env misconfig**

Welcome aboard! So the Fernhaven greenhouse controller has been reporting humidity drifting way off baseline since last week. Turns out the staging `.env` got copied to the Bay 3 unit, which points calibration at the wrong profile. Fix: set `CALIBRATION_PROFILE=bay3-prod` and `DRIFT_CORRECTION=on`, then restart the Sproutline agent. The agent also re-registers with the telemetry hub on boot, and that handshake fails without credentials — so add this line to the env file first:

env line for kageg-fajof: COURIER_KEY5=93d14

TICKET: PERF-2291 — Template render regression

p95 render time up 3x after Thursday's Inkbarrow deploy. Suspect the new partial-inclusion resolver; it re-parses shared partials per request instead of using the compiled cache. Rollback prepared and staged. Need sign-off before pushing to prod — on-call cannot self-approve perf rollbacks per policy. Benchmark diff attached to the ticket. Approval required from the rendering performance owner, named below.

account owner for bawip-tahag: Raleth Quenok